Firey Grilled Shrimp Recipe

Ingredients:

A handful of parsley
2 lbs. of Shrimp
6 cloves of garlic
2 tbsps. of excellent olive oil
Zest of lemon (reserve juice on the side)
A handful of pecorino reggiano cheese
1 tsp. capers
Salt and fresh cracked pepper

Directions:

© Remove shell from shrimp, while leaving the tail on. Remove the vein from the backside of the shrimp. Rinse and pat dry.

Place shrimp into a plastic bag, add ingredients. Blend in bag. Seal it tight Marinate overnight.
Ready for grilling!

*Parsley Pesto Sauce goes great with this delicious appetizer.
